 | Seinosuke Yokota Out 5 Months Friday, September 5th, 2014 Disappointing news today for Chippewa River Chiefs fans. Seinosuke Yokota was hurt throwing a pitch in their game against the Coney Island Cyclones and has a sore shoulder. Team trainers were hesitant to predict a date for return but said it was likely the injury will keep the reliever out at least 5 months.
Yokota has earned 1 save and a 0-3 mark this season with a 4.26 earned run average in 37 relief appearances. He has worked 44.1 innings, yielded 50 hits, struck out 20 batters and walked 24. |   |
